    Did I do my math correct?

    While calculating peak input voltage, don't use the Voc on the panel's label, since this is at 25 C cell temperature. Instead, estimate the Voc at the lowest temperature the panels are likely to see. Use the panels temperature coefficient for voltage for this calculation.

    Finally, initial Electrocacus DSSR vs MPPT side-by-side/RW results ... and they're SHOCKING! lol

    Partial (or full) shade & PV don't mix! Wire the panels in parallel to make sure a shaded panel does not affect the whole system. If series wired, bypass diodes may help, but not always. The MPPT algorithm can be easily fooled by multiple (local) max power points that may occur in such...
